Tom, If you shop around you should be able to find either new Polycom 320's or perhaps some used or refurbished Polycom's or Cisco's for very reasonable prices. I'd suggest contacting a reseller and telling them you're looking for used or refurbs. I know I've gotten some open box IP 320's for around $70 US (with full warranty).
Of course you may need new wiring and POE switches but the time you'll save in the long run will off-set any cost difference. I'd think the net5501 should be able to handle the 8 channels without a problem. I don't have a T1 card, but I do have that same Rhino card with 5 dual fxo's and two dual fxs's on a net5501 working flawlessly.
